A Bay Ridge, Brooklyn walking tour that focuses on personal ghost anecdotes, stories of unsolved murders, and other spooky Bay Ridge history
About this Event

Missed last Autumn's Haunted Bay Ridge walking tour! You're in luck. I'm leading this special revised edition of the Haunted Bay Ridge walking tour on when else, 6/6!


From a faceless woman late one night on a lonely street near a local church, to army ghosts and disembodied sounds, to the murders of an old spinster and kidnappers, to the mysteries of the neighborhood's largest park, to a secret society right in our midst, it’s time to turn up our collars, hit the streets, and beware the things that go bump in the night.


Led by James Scully — NYC historian, tour guide, podcaster, director / co-creator of the award-winning historical audio fiction soap opera, , and creator of the — our unique haunted Bay Ridge experience will focus on and include:


• Stories of M**der and mayhem, from the death of an old spinster, to the heroic actions of a member of a prominent family, we’ll find out the many motives for crime and how Bay Ridge was the perfect setting for these unfortunate events.


• The story of how a man’s late-night walk down a Brooklyn side-street led him to confront the spirit of a veiled woman with no face in front of a locally famous Basilica


• The story of how a secret society of skull worshipers in Brooklyn started, rose, peaked, and disappeared all near a famous hilltop Bay Ridge mansion


• Ghost stories from both the Fort Hamilton Army base and some of its residents


• The story of the Indian Pond, the border of Gravesend and New Utrecht, and a boy awoken from sleep in the middle of the night by a shadow being standing over his bed


• The story of a revolutionary war cemetery still inhabited by some of Bay Ridge’s most famous residents

About James


James Scully is an outgoing native New Yorker who grew up in a Bensonhurst home with four generations of family. He had close relationships with both his grandparents and great-grandparents. This exposed him to an invaluable amount of local history and culture, helping him to become a passionate historian, writer, and director.


He’s a graduate of Xavier High School in Manhattan, Pratt Institute in Brooklyn, and spent over a decade working as an art director and copywriter for media companies such as Condé Nast and Hearst before becoming a writer, director, and historian. His history focus is both New York City history and US radio history.


James produces and hosts The Bay Ridge Digest Podcast (https://bayridgedigest.com) . He has also developed historical audio fiction productions, like the 2022 official Tribeca audio selection Burning Gotham, set in 1835 New York City (http://burninggotham.com).


James is a member of the Salmagundi Club, has given numerous talks and webinars on various history subjects, and is a New York City sightseeing/tour guide.
